JDBC连接数据库的六大步骤
1. 加载驱动
Class.forName("com.mysql.jdbc.Driver");
2. 创建连接对象
String url = "jdbc:mysql://localhost:3306/test";
String user = "root";
String password = "123456";
Connection conn = DriverManager.getConnection(url, user, password);
3. 创建执行sql语句的对象,传参。
Statement statement = conn.createStatement();
4. 执行sql语句,获取返回的结果集。
String sql = " select * from test";
ResultSet resultSet = statement.executeQuery(sql);
5. 解析结果集
while(resultSet.next()) {
resultSet.getInt(1);
resultSet.getString(2);
}
6.释放资源
resultSet.close();
statement.close();
conn.close();
7.代码示例:
public static void main(String[] args) throws Exception {
// 1. 加载驱动
Class.forName("com.mysql.jdbc.Driver");
// 2.创建连接对象
String url = "jdbc:mysql://localhost:3306/test";
String user = "root";
String password = "123456";
Connection conn = DriverManager.getConnection(url, user, password);
// 3. 创建执行sql语句的对象,传参
Statement statement = conn.createStatement();
// 4.执行sql语句
String sql = " select * from test";
ResultSet resultSet = statement.executeQuery(sql);
// 5. 解析结果集
while(resultSet.next()) {
resultSet.getInt(1);
resultSet.getString(2);
}
// 6.释放资源
resultSet.close();
statement.close();
conn.close();
}
版权声明:本文为xuewei_ing原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。